Lake Branchino is located in the Orobie Prealps, between the Seriana and Brembana valleys, on the administrative border between the municipalities of Ardesio and Oltre il Colle. It is possible to reach the lake from three different points: from the Seriana valley, starting from Valcanale, a hamlet of Ardesio and following the CAI trail number 220 that reaches the Alpe Corte refuge and, passing alongside numerous huts, goes up to the Branchino refuge and then to the lake; from the Brembana valley, from the town of Roncobello via a carriage road that touches the locality of Costa Superiore and the hamlet of Capovalle. A little further upstream the trail becomes a path, along which follow the signs for the Branchino pass; from the Serina valley, via trail number 222 that goes up to the Capanna 2000 refuge and then continuing along the Sentiero dei Fiori

Beautiful artificial lakes (originally, before the construction of the dam, there were two lakes and of much smaller dimensions, then as the water level rose they joined) set in a basin that offers spectacular views and landscapes. The path that goes all around the lake is very beautiful. The vegetation is mostly herbaceous and shrubby, with the presence of sporadic larches. Wonderful in all seasons, but autumn for the play of colors and winter for snowshoeing are definitely the two most suitable.

The area around Serina, in the upper Brembana valley, features several appreciated lakes. Among the most popular are Laghi Gemelli Mountain Hut, situated on the shores of the famous Twin Lakes, and Lago Marcio, an artificial lake known for its stunning reflections of Pizzo Farno. Visitors also frequently explore the Twin Lakes themselves, located at an altitude of approximately 1952m.
Yes, many of the lakes around Serina are integrated into scenic hiking routes. For example, a popular circular route starts from Carona and passes by the Laghi Gemelli Mountain Hut, Lago Marcio, and Lake Piano Casere. Yes, the Laghi Gemelli Mountain Hut is a well-known refuge located directly on the shores of the Twin Lakes. It offers traditional cuisine and a hospitable welcome to hikers, including overnight stays. Lake Piano Casere is also not far from this refuge.
Lago Marcio, despite its name, is considered one of the most fascinating lakes in the Twin Lakes basin. It's an artificial lake particularly known for its captivating basin where the majestic Pizzo Farno is reflected, offering a breathtaking view, especially on clear days. It's also part of popular circular hiking routes.
The Twin Lakes, located in the municipality of Branzi at an altitude of approximately 1952m, are significant for their unique formation. While often appearing as one large body of water, they originally consisted of two basins that were transformed by human intervention into a larger, single lake. They are a prominent feature in the upper Brembana valley.
